They were Zhang Zuolin, the king of the northeast, Feng Yuxiang of the northwest, Sun Chuanfang, the king of the southeast, and Tang Jiyao, the king of the southwest. First of all, let's talk about Zhang Zuolin, the king of the northeast, Zhang Zuolin was very famous at that time, and originally before the fall of Dongshan Province, the Zhang family originally managed this area by themselves. The Japanese army was also afraid of Zhang Zuolin, and did not dare to invade the three eastern provinces.

The King of the Northwest can be regarded as a self-made warlord, he is Feng Yuxiang. Feng Yuxiang was involved in a major event in 1924, that is, the overthrow of the original direct warlords. After this, Feng Yuxiang occupied many places, such as Shanxi, Henan and Hebei. Soon he had a large army and became the king of the northwest.

The third southeast king, Sun Chuanfang, sun Chuanfang had such a good achievement at that time, because he had traveled to many places to fight. Sun Chuanfang belonged to the warlords of Zhejiang, and at his peak, he once had a military strength of 300,000 people. In 1925, he defeated the Suwan warlords. However, the good times did not last long, and in 1927, because the Northern Expedition of the National Revolutionary Army was blocked, the military strength this time was greatly reduced. Since then, it has declined.

The fourth king of the southwest, Tang Jiyao, was a knowledgeable man from an early age, attending the Zhenwu School in Tokyo, Japan in 1904, and then became the founder of the Dian Army. Also committed to the development of a modern army, and once occupied Kunming, for the modernization of Yunnan, Tang Jiyao played a role in promoting and promoting, and even controlled Guangxi. Historically, Tang Jiyao is a figure who has been controversial.
